LECTURE AND BOOK SIGNING | DesignPhiladelphia Lecture: Cynthia E. Smith
Tuesday, April 3
6:00–7:30 p.m.
The University of the Arts, Hamilton Hall, 320 S. Broad Street
Philadelphia, PA
Cynthia E. Smith’s recent exhibitions, Design for the Other 90% at Cooper-Hewitt, National Design Museum and Design with the Other 90%: CITIES at the United Nations, sparked international dialogue on the opportunities to utilize technology and design to help poorer communities "leapfrog" into the 21st century. Traditionally, designers focused on the 10% of the population that could afford their goods and services. Now, a new wave of designers, architects and engineers is working to solve the world's most critical problems as urban populations in the developing world grow at unprecedented rates.
